Overview of Fluid Recruiting
Fluid Recruiting is an HTML recruiting solution that helps enterprises assess and hire the best talent.
Fluid Recruiting offers a simple and modern user interface usable on desktop, laptop, tablet, and smartphone. Fluid Recruiting works on the Oracle Taleo Enterprise Edition platform, capitalizing on the same user accounts, user types, user permissions, settings, and other configuration. Fluid Recruiting uses concepts, icons, data and behavior similar to the Recruiting Center while providing an improved user experience.
Users can use Fluid Recruiting in parallel with the existing Recruiting Center. They can process requisitions and candidates in Fluid Recruiting. If they need to take further actions, they can return to the Recruiting Center to complete the tasks.
Mobile Support
Fluid Recruiting is supported on a variety of devices. Whether a desktop or smartphone is used, the UI will adjust to render the optimal experience on the device.
For example, viewing and navigating into submission details has been optimized on the smartphone. Instead of displaying all of the submission details (which can result in a lot of scrolling on a phone’s small screen), the view initially opens on the submission’s summary card and users can flip to view other submissions while always viewing this same level of detail. If necessary, users can click to see the complete submission details. The same applies to the requisition details.
Because of the limited space on smartphones, the information is displayed differently than on a desktop. For example, on smartphones and portrait mode of tablets, the columns displayed in requisitions and submissions lists are limited and lists cannot be sorted. Also, submission disposition actions are only available in the details page (and not on the list page).
Language Support
Fluid Recruiting supports the same set of languages as the Recruiting Center. All languages activated in the Recruiting Center are reflected in Fluid Recruiting.
Permissions and Access
Users have access to different Oracle Taleo Enterprise Edition products according to their user permissions.
Fluid Recruiting has been renamed to Recruiting, while the Recruiting Center (flash-based) has been renamed Legacy Recruiting. On the Welcome Center, the primary Recruiting link takes you to Fluid Recruiting (Recruiting) and a Legacy Recruiting link takes you to Legacy Recruiting (Recruiting Center). You can toggle back and forth between Legacy Recruiting and Recruiting.
To access Fluid Recruiting (Recruiting), the following user type permission is required. This permission is available under SmartOrg Administration > User Types > Recruiting > Other > General.
Access Fluid Recruiting
All user types who have access to the Recruiting Center (Legacy Recruiting) also have access to Recruiting (Fluid Recruiting). You can grant the Access Fluid Recruiting permission to user types where it isn’t granted yet, however, you can't create new user types with only the Legacy Recruiting permission. Once granted, the Access Fluid Recruiting permission can't be rescinded.
Deep Links to Access Specific Pages and Tasks
Fluid Recruiting supports certain URLs to go direclty to specific pages or tasks.
Deep links are useful when you need for instance to send a URL to users in an email, portal, or other environments outside Taleo's application (including eShare) to allow them to navigate directly to a page or task in the application. Users click the URL and they’re redirected to a specific requisition, submission, or candidate profile with appropriate instructions to complete the task.
To create a URL that directs users to a page to perform a specific action, certain parameters are required. Here’s an example of a URL that directs users to a requisition that needs approval.
http://client.taleo.net/enterprise/publicurl/tasks?type=approveRequisition&requisitionNumber=7317
Parameter | Description | Example |
---|---|---|
<Product URL> | Taleo product identifier URL. | http://c;lient.taleo.net/enterprise/publicjurl/tasks |
<action> | Action available for the product. | approveRequisition |
<parameter> | Parameter identifier. | requisitionNumber |
<value> | Key value. | 7317 |
